Stryve Foods, Inc. filed an 8-K with the Securities and Exchange Commission on June 9, 2023, continuing its public-company reporting obligations as the successor entity to Andina Acquisition Corp. III, which traded on Nasdaq under the ticker ANDA. Andina Acquisition Corp. III, sponsored by Andina Holdings LLC, priced its IPO in 2019 as a blank-check vehicle targeting the consumer goods sector. The SPAC completed its de-SPAC business combination with Stryve Foods in 2021, bringing the biltong and protein-snack brand to public markets. As of the filing date, the combined company was operating as a publicly traded consumer packaged goods business.
